This striking 4 Cents stamp from Labuan (British North Borneo) features the iconic orangutan design originally used by North Borneo. Overprinted boldly with “LABUAN”, it reflects the island’s transitional postal administration under British protection. The vivid red frame and detailed engraved vignette highlight classic Bornean wildlife themes prized by collectors. Such overprinted issues are widely sought after for their historical significance, tropical imagery, and limited print context. A fine philatelic piece representing late-19th to early-20th century North Borneo postal history.
